Replies: 1 comment
-
Für einen PR musst du einen Fork erstellen und die Änderungen dort in einem Branch in dein Fork pushen. Dann kannst in Github in deinem Fork dafür einen PR für das Repo hier machen. |
Beta Was this translation helpful? Give feedback.
0 replies
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
-
Hallo zusammen,
nachdem ich nun mehrere Tage gesucht habe, wie ich die residualPower konfigurieren kann, bin ich an der Rechenlogik leicht verzweifelt.
Zunächst für alle Interessierten, die residualPower (Puffer des Hausverbrauches) wird wohl so gesetzt:
Anscheinend wird in der gesamten Logik der Export NEGATIV erwartet. Die evcc.dist.yaml geht da leider nicht drauf ein.
Der "enable threshold" wird mit "0 W" angegeben. Rein logisch hätte ich hier jetzt auch eine positive Zahl eingetragen.
Im Log sah ich dann, dass der Timer ablief, obwohl der Export bei weitem nicht die Grenze erreicht hatte:
der enable threshold muss also in der evcc.yaml negativ angegeben werden!
Im Code habe ich das gefunden:
grid = negative Zahl
battery = negative Zahl
residual = positive Zahl
Beispiel1: Export ist gerade 3500, residualPower ist 1000, threshold ist -2000.
Rechnung: ( (- 3500) + (1000) ) = -2500 (sitePowe) < -2000 --> enable Timer Startet!
Beispiel2: Export 2500, residualPower 1000, threshold -2000.
Rechnung: ( (-2500) + (1000) ) = -1500 > -2000 --> enable Timer startet nicht!
Wer also die residualPower nutzt, muss den Wert von der threshold abziehen.
Meine PV macht 9,1kWP. Begrenzt aber Export auf 70% = 6,4kW.
Wenn ich also die ungenutzten 2,7kW an guten Tagen noch nutzen will, muss threshold = -5400, WENN residualPower = 1000.
Wenn man das weiß, macht die Logik dann auch Sinn.
Ich würde vorschlagen, die Beispiele entsprechend an zu passen.
Habs schon selber versucht (pull request), aber sehe die noch nicht unter https://github.com/andig/evcc/pulls.
Bin aber auch nicht so vertraut mit github.
PS: ich hoffe, ihr versteht mich :D
Beta Was this translation helpful? Give feedback.
All reactions